New York/ Laguardia, Ny vs Fayetteville, Ar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between New York/ Laguardia, Ny, Usa and Fayetteville, Ar, Usa is approximately 1,826 km or 1,135 mi.
  • To reach New York/ Laguardia, Ny in this distance one would set out from Fayetteville, Ar bearing 67.1°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ach New York/ Laguardia, Ny bearing 79.6° or E .
  •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Both are in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 1.7 °C (3.1°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.3 °C (0.5°F) more in New York/ Laguardia, Ny.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 48.7 mm (1.9 in) less which is equivalent to 48.7 l/m² (1.2 US gal/ft²) or 487,000 l/ha (52,064 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.8° lower in New York/ Laguardia, Ny than in Fayetteville, Ar.
